Decoding The Rhizomatic Meaning: Philosophy, Systems, And Network Theory
The term "rhizomatic" has transcended its origins in botany to become a cornerstone concept in philosophy, sociology, and network architecture. At its core, the rhizomatic meaning describes a structure that is non-hierarchical, decentralized, and constantly expanding through connections rather than a singular point of origin. Unlike a tree-like (arborescent) structure, which relies on a taproot and a vertical hierarchy, a rhizome thrives on lateral growth, resilience, and adaptability.
When we look at the world through a rhizomatic lens, we move away from traditional top-down models of authority and knowledge. Instead, we see a vast, interconnected web where any point can be linked to any other point. This conceptual framework has profound implications for how we organize digital data, social movements, and even human thought processes in an increasingly fragmented reality.
The Philosophical Roots: Deleuze and Guattari’s Vision
The concept of the rhizome was popularized by French philosophers Gilles Deleuze and Félix Guattari in their seminal work, A Thousand Plateaus. They utilized the botanical rhizome—a subterranean stem system like ginger or grass—to illustrate a model of knowledge and culture that rejects the binary, linear logic of Western thought. In their view, traditional knowledge systems are "arborescent," meaning they are rooted, hierarchical, and fixed in place.
Deleuze and Guattari argued that the rhizome possesses no center, no beginning, and no end. It is always in the middle, between things. This allows for a "multiplicity" where ideas can emerge from any direction. If you sever one part of a rhizomatic structure, it does not die; it merely adapts and continues to grow from a different node. This philosophy has become essential for understanding postmodernism, where truth is not a monolithic structure but a shifting collection of perspectives.
In modern intellectual discourse, this is often applied to interdisciplinary studies. Instead of keeping academic fields siloed—like history, science, and art—a rhizomatic approach encourages the blurring of these boundaries. It suggests that information is most valuable when it flows freely between domains, creating new "assemblages" of thought that wouldn't exist within rigid, hierarchical systems.
Practical Applications in Network Theory and Digital Architecture
In the realm of computer science and network architecture, the rhizomatic meaning is more than just a metaphor; it is a structural blueprint. Decentralized networks, such as blockchain technology and mesh Wi-Fi systems, operate on rhizomatic principles. In these systems, there is no central server or "root" that controls the entirety of the network. If one node fails, the rest of the network remains operational, rerouting traffic through remaining nodes.
This resilience is why decentralized networks are highly resistant to censorship and system crashes. By removing the dependency on a central authority, data becomes fluid and distributed. Comparison: Arborescent vs. Rhizomatic Structures
To truly grasp the rhizomatic meaning, it is essential to compare it against the traditional, hierarchical model. The following table highlights the fundamental differences between these two ways of organizing information and power.
| Feature | Arborescent (Hierarchical) | Rhizomatic (Decentralized) |
|---|---|---|
| Origin | Single root/source | No origin; multiple entry points |
| Growth | Vertical (top-down) | Lateral (multi-directional) |
| Resilience | Low; if root dies, system fails | High; nodes are autonomous |
| Logic | Binary (True/False) | Multiplicity (Interconnected) |
| Adaptability | Rigid and slow to change | Highly fluid and reactive |
| Communication | Top-down broadcast | Peer-to-peer exchange |
Addressing the Ambiguity: The Rhizomatic Botanical Context
While the philosophical definition is the most searched, we must not ignore the literal botanical meaning. A rhizome is a modified subterranean plant stem that sends out roots and shoots from its nodes. Plants like turmeric, ginger, bamboo, and certain types of grass are all rhizomatic. Unlike a bulb or a traditional root, the rhizome serves as a storage organ, holding nutrients that allow the plant to survive adverse conditions.
From a gardening or agricultural perspective, understanding the rhizomatic meaning is crucial for propagation. Because rhizomes grow laterally, they can be divided into segments—each containing at least one node—to propagate new, independent plants. This creates a natural cloning effect, ensuring the species continues to spread across a plot of land.
This biological reality provides a physical anchor for the philosophical metaphor. The plant's ability to survive and spread through underground connections serves as a perfect symbol for the distributed, persistent nature of rhizomatic networks in sociology and technology. Whether it is in your garden or your database, the core principle remains: survival through connectivity and expansion.
